mess waistcoat

Accession Number NWHRM : 1476

Description

Mess waistcoat, c.1850, worn by Lieutenant Colonel Duncan Munro Bethune, 9th (East Norfolk) Regiment of Foot, which would become the Norfolk Regiment in 1881. Scarlet with decorative metallic piping at the pockets and opening, with heavy spherical gold beads to one side of the centre.
